Form 4: Jones Lang LaSalle Director Tina L. Ju Acquires Shares in Lieu of Cash Compensation

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4 Filing


Director Tina L. Ju acquired 219 shares of Jones Lang LaSalle Inc. common stock on June 28, 2024, in lieu of cash compensation under the company's Non-Executive Director Compensation program.

Summary

  • On June 28, 2024, Tina L. Ju, a director of Jones Lang LaSalle Inc. (JLL), acquired 219 shares of JLL common stock.
  • The shares were received in lieu of the annual cash retainer payable quarterly in advance for the third quarter of fiscal year 2024.
  • The shares were also received in lieu of annual committee cash retainers for Committee Chair or Member paid annually in the third quarter.
  • This acquisition was made in accordance with a prior election under the Non-Executive Director Compensation program.
  • The receipt of these shares has been deferred pursuant to the Jones Lang LaSalle Inc. Deferred Compensation Plan.
  • Following the transaction, Ms. Ju beneficially owns 6,291 shares of JLL common stock.

Industry Context

Directors often receive compensation in the form of stock to align their interests with shareholders and promote long-term value creation. This is a common practice in publicly traded companies.

Comparison to Industry Standards

  • Many companies offer non-executive directors the option to receive equity in lieu of cash compensation.
  • Deferred compensation plans are also common, allowing directors to defer income and potentially reduce their tax burden while further aligning their interests with the company's long-term performance.
